Mable T. Ruesch, age 84 of Maynard died on November 7, 2012 at Rice Memorial Hospital in Willmar. Funeral service will be 2:00 pm on Monday, November 12, 2012 at Immanuel Lutheran Church in Clara City. Burial will be in the church cemetery. Visitation will be from 5-7pm on Sunday at Harvey Anderson Funeral Home in Clara City and will continue one hour prior to the service at the church on Monday.

Mable Tillie Ruesch was born on September 11, 1928 in Rheiderland Twp., Chippewa County, Minnesota, the daughter of Kasjen and Augusta (Miller) Niemeyer. She grew up in the Clara City / Maynard area where she attended country school. She worked with her sister at a cafe in Gluek. She married Elmer Iffert. On December 11, 1961 was united in marriage to Lloyd Ruesch in Montevideo. The couple lived and farmed in the Maynard area.

Mable was baptized and confirmed at Immanuel Lutheran Church in Clara City where she was later active with ladies aid. She was also a member of the D.A. V. Auxiliary in Montevideo and 40/8 in Montevideo.

Mable enjoyed playing cards, doing latch hook rugs, and visiting with friends. She cherished the times she could spend with her family. Her family will remember her excellent cooking especially her pot roast.

Mable is survived by her husband Lloyd Ruesch of Maynard; son Willis Iffert; daughter Lucinda Gavere; four grandchildren and seven great-grandchildren; brother August Niemeyer and other relatives.

She was preceded in death by her parents; son-in-law David Gavere, brother, Ervin Niemeyer and sister Sophie Bodin.
